What are the most common immigration issues that attorneys help with for people in the Rolling Fork area?

Given the agricultural and family-oriented nature of the Mississippi Delta region, common immigration matters include family-based petitions (for spouses, children, or parents), agricultural worker visas (like H-2A), and naturalization applications. Attorneys also frequently assist with renewals or adjustments of status, DACA inquiries, and responding to notices from U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S). Understanding the local economic drivers is key for attorneys serving this community.

How can I verify if an immigration attorney serving Rolling Fork is reputable and authorized to practice?

It is crucial to verify an attorney's credentials. You should check their status with the Mississippi State Bar to ensure they are licensed and in good standing. Furthermore, for immigration-specific expertise, look for attorneys who are members of the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A), a national organization of legal professionals. Be wary of notarios or immigration consultants who are not licensed attorneys, as they cannot provide legal representation.

If I have a court hearing at the Memphis Immigration Court, how does an attorney in Mississippi assist me?

The Memphis Immigration Court has jurisdiction over cases for individuals in Mississippi, including Rolling Fork residents. A Mississippi-licensed immigration attorney can represent you before this court. They will handle all filings, communicate with the court on your behalf, and prepare you for hearings, which may require travel to Memphis, Tennessee. Your attorney will guide you through the entire process and explain the specific logistics and requirements for your case.
